Fans flooded downtown Los Angeles on Monday to celebrate the Dodgers’ World Series Championship parade and rally. Players rode buses through the city streets while cheering fans lined the route. The buses then proceeded to Dodger Stadium for a sold-out rally where players addressed the crowd.
This marked the Dodgers' ninth World Series title and their first back-to-back championship win.
